DEFINITION
What Is a Psychological Check-In?
A Psychological Check-In is an annual session designed to refresh and refine your psychological and educational support plan. Whether you're a student with an IEP, a young adult navigating post-secondary accommodations, or a parent monitoring your child’s developmental progress, this service helps ensure you're equipped for success.
These sessions provide an opportunity to evaluate academic or developmental progress, review prior assessments and recommendations, update school or workplace-related documentation, revisit learning goals, emotional challenges, or behavioural concerns, and plan ahead for transitions or future assessments
Psychological Check-Ins Are Ideal For:
Students with IEPs or academic accommodations
Individuals who’ve previously undergone assessments and need updates
Families preparing for key educational transitions (e.g., elementary to high school, high school to university)
Post-secondary students requiring documentation for academic accommodations
Individuals seeking support in aligning educational and emotional development
Anyone looking to reflect on their progress and prepare for what’s next

Why It Matters
Psychological Check-Ins are more than just a review—they’re a proactive way to ensure you or your child has the right tools to thrive. They support ongoing development, improve communication between families and schools, and help keep mental health support consistent and effective. Whether you're navigating a new grade, planning for university, or managing learning needs in the workplace, these sessions offer continuity, clarity, and confidence.
Frequently Asked Questions
How often should the Psychological Check-in occur?
It is recommended annually to align the assessment with your child's evolving educational and developmental needs.
Why is the Psychological Check-in important?
This check-in ensures that any adjustments needed in your child's educational and developmental support are made timely, fostering optimal growth and success.
What is included in the Psychological Check-in?
The check-in includes an evaluation of your child’s emotional state, developmental progress, and academic performance, alongside updates to their Individual Education Plan.
